On July 23, 2026, my brother visited Store #1961 and worked with an associate named Sanya. She initially told him she could not find a truck to send the package overnight. A short time later, she said she had found one. We paid $126 for overnight shipping and were assured that the package, a cell phone valued at more than $1,000, would be delivered in New Jersey by 8:00 a.m. the following morning.
By 11:00 a.m., the package had still not been delivered. When I checked the tracking information, the only update was "Label Created." There were no acceptance scans or any indication that UPS had ever taken possession of the package.
I called the store seeking answers and spoke with the owner. Rather than showing concern, taking responsibility, or attempting to investigate what happened, he was rude, dismissive, and unprofessional. He repeatedly blamed UPS for the missing package, even though the tracking history does not show UPS ever accepting or scanning it. Instead of contacting his associate to determine what happened, he insisted it was UPS's fault and then hung up on me.
What is most concerning is the complete lack of accountability. We entrusted this store with a phone worth more than $1,000, paid a premium for overnight shipping, and were met with indifference when the package could not be accounted for. At this point, neither the store nor the owner has been able to explain what happened to the package or provide any evidence that it was ever turned over to UPS.
